Description of Hawaiian Electric Industries Inc

Hawaiian Electric Industries, Inc. (HEI) is a public utility holding company headquartered in Honolulu, Hawaii. The company operates through two subsidiaries: Hawaiian Electric Company, Inc. (HECO) and American Savings Bank, FSB (ASB). HECO is the largest utility company in Hawaii, where it generates and distributes electricity to over 95% of the population. ASB is the third largest bank in Hawaii, with over 50 branches across the state.

HEI was founded in 1891, and has a long history of providing reliable and affordable energy services to the people of Hawaii. The company has developed a diversified fuel mix, consisting of renewable and non-renewable sources, to ensure energy security for the state. HECO operates a mix of power plants, including coal, oil, natural gas, and renewable energy sources such as wind, solar, hydro, and geothermal. In 2020, HECO generated over 3,600 gigawatt-hours (GWh) of electricity from renewable sources, which is equivalent to 33% of its total electricity generated.

HEI has also implemented various programs to promote energy efficiency and conservation among its customers. These programs include rebates for energy-efficient appliances, lighting, and HVAC systems, as well as demand response programs that incentivize customers to reduce their energy usage during times of peak demand.

Aside from its energy business, HEI has a strong presence in the financial industry through its subsidiary, ASB. The bank offers a range of financial products and services, including personal and business banking, home loans, and investment services. ASB has been recognized for its commitment to the community, supporting various nonprofit organizations and initiatives in Hawaii.

Hawaiian Electric Industries Inc. (HEI) serves as a holding company for several key utilities in Hawaii, including Hawaiian Electric Company, Maui Electric Company, and Hawaii Electric Light Company. Collectively, these entities provide electric service to over 95% of Hawaiis population.

Segments

HEI operates across three primary segments, each contributing to the companys overall mission of providing sustainable energy solutions and essential banking services:

1. Electric Utility
- Overview: This segment encompasses the comprehensive activities of producing, purchasing, and distributing electricity to residential and commercial consumers across Hawaii. The utility segments operations include managing a diverse energy portfolio and pursuing innovative energy solutions.
- Renewable Energy Commitment: HEI is increasingly investing in renewable sources of energy such as solar, wind, and geothermal. The company has set ambitious goals, such as achieving 100% renewable energy by 2045.
- Energy Efficiency Programs: In addition to traditional power supply, HEI develops and implements energy efficiency programs to help customers reduce their overall consumption. These programs include incentives for adopting energy-efficient appliances and technologies.
- Solar Initiatives: HEI supports the installation of solar panels for both residential and commercial properties, fostering greater self-sufficiency in energy use.

2. Bank
- Overview: The Bank segment primarily comprises American Savings Bank, which serves as a full-service banking institution providing a broad spectrum of banking and financial services to residents and businesses in Hawaii and the Pacific Islands.
- Products and Services: American Savings Bank offers checking and savings accounts, business loans, mortgages, credit cards, and investment opportunities. The bank is integral to the local economic environment, aiming to meet the financial needs of its customers while contributing to community growth.

3. Other
- Overview: This segment includes various investments in unconsolidated affiliates, joint ventures, and ancillary business activities. These ventures allow HEI to diversify its portfolio and engage in strategic partnerships that can enhance its core operations.
- Business Activities: In addition to energy utilities and banking, this segment might also encompass leasing subsidiaries and other investments, enhancing overall revenue sources for HEI.
